The capital city of Saudi Arabia is gearing up for one of the most anticipated sporting events of the year, the Battle of the Giants. Set to take place on Saturday, October 19, 2024, at the state-of-the-art Mayadeen Venue in Diriyah, this event promises an adrenaline-filled night as some of the biggest names in mixed martial arts (MMA) go head-to-head. With only a few weeks remaining, fans from across the globe are preparing for an unforgettable spectacle in Riyadh.

Organized by the Professional Fighters League (PFL) in collaboration with the Saudi Mixed Martial Arts Federation, the Battle of the Giants will feature an action-packed card, headlined by a fierce heavyweight showdown. MMA superstar Francis Ngannou, also known as “The Predator,” will make his highly anticipated return to the ring to challenge reigning PFL Heavyweight Champion Renan Ferreira for the prestigious PFL Super Fights Championship Belt. Ferreira, who stands an imposing 6 feet 8 inches tall, is renowned for his knockout power and poses a serious threat to Ngannou’s bid to reclaim his place at the top of the sport.

In addition to the explosive main event, the co-main bout will see the legendary Cris “Cyborg” defend her title in the Women’s Featherweight division against Larissa Pacheco. The Brazilian fighter, who is widely regarded as one of the greatest female MMA fighters in history, will face a formidable opponent in Pacheco, a two-division PFL champion with a point to prove.

But the night’s excitement doesn’t stop there. A third title fight will see undefeated Bellator middleweight world champion Johnny Eblen take on Fabian Edwards in a highly anticipated rematch. Edwards, who gave Eblen a tough battle in 2023, is eager to claim the middleweight world title, having narrowly missed out last time due to a TKO in the third round.

The undercard is equally thrilling, featuring rising stars and seasoned veterans alike. At lightweight, former Bellator featherweight champion A.J. McKee will face Northern Irish prospect Paul Hughes, who is considered by many to be the next big name in MMA. Meanwhile, the featherweight division will see Switzerland’s Husein Kadimagomaev take on Germany’s Zafar Mohsen in what promises to be a hard-hitting clash. Both fighters come with impressive records and are eager to make their mark on this grand stage.

Saudi fans will also have their own star to root for, as local fighter Mostafa Nada squares off against Egypt’s Ahmed Sami in a middleweight contest. This fight is sure to add a regional flavor to the evening’s international line-up, offering spectators a chance to cheer on homegrown talent.

Ticket prices for the event start at SAR 300, with premium seating options, such as the KO Kingdom, available for between SAR 1,500 and SAR 2,000. Those lucky enough to secure ringside tickets will also gain access to the exclusive PFL Lounge, complete with complimentary food, drinks, VIP parking, and merchandise vouchers. All ticket categories come with access to the fan zone, ensuring a full day of entertainment for everyone in attendance.
